summaryrefslogtreecommitdiff
path: root/src/gmrequest.c
diff options
context:
space:
mode:
authorJaakko Keränen <jaakko.keranen@iki.fi>2020-07-31 09:22:56 +0300
committerJaakko Keränen <jaakko.keranen@iki.fi>2020-07-31 09:22:56 +0300
commit3b76ce224e40f670c0988985d9a9405edb7ed24d (patch)
tree40040d74d869cfcef46493e4d0c4c35da98c09d4 /src/gmrequest.c
parentd8f9c8c034c263b0939b0afe8150fdf8490e0077 (diff)
GmRequest: Print the server certificate for testing
Diffstat (limited to 'src/gmrequest.c')
-rw-r--r--src/gmrequest.c8
1 files changed, 8 insertions, 0 deletions
diff --git a/src/gmrequest.c b/src/gmrequest.c
index 25ff90af..5ee3382c 100644
--- a/src/gmrequest.c
+++ b/src/gmrequest.c
@@ -164,6 +164,14 @@ static void requestFinished_GmRequest_(iAnyObject *obj) {
164 SDL_RemoveTimer(d->timeoutId); 164 SDL_RemoveTimer(d->timeoutId);
165 d->timeoutId = 0; 165 d->timeoutId = 0;
166 d->state = finished_GmRequestState; 166 d->state = finished_GmRequestState;
167#if 0
168 printf("Server certificate:\n%s\n",
169 cstrLocal_String(pem_TlsCertificate(serverCertificate_TlsRequest(d->req))));
170 iDate expiry;
171 validUntil_TlsCertificate(serverCertificate_TlsRequest(d->req), &expiry);
172 printf("Valid until %04d-%02d-%02d\n", expiry.year, expiry.month, expiry.day);
173 printf("Subject: %s\n", cstrLocal_String(subject_TlsCertificate(serverCertificate_TlsRequest(d->req))));
174#endif
167 unlock_Mutex(&d->mutex); 175 unlock_Mutex(&d->mutex);
168 iNotifyAudience(d, finished, GmRequestFinished); 176 iNotifyAudience(d, finished, GmRequestFinished);
169} 177}